Job Summary
We are seeking a dynamic and highly skilled IBM Openpage Consultant to join our innovative team. In this role, you will leverage your expertise in enterprise risk management, compliance, and governance solutions to help clients optimize their Openpage platform. Your energetic approach will drive successful implementation, integration, and customization of IBM Openpage, ensuring organizations meet their regulatory and security objectives. This position offers an exciting opportunity to work at the forefront of IT security and compliance technology, empowering clients with robust solutions that enhance operational resilience.

Job Description:

3-8 years of experience with OpenPages versions 8.2 and GRC functionalities.

Proficiency in Java/J2EE, SQL (Oracle/DB2), HTML/XML, JSP, JavaScript, and Cognos Analytics.

Strong analytical skills, problem-solving, communication, and knowledge of SDLC best practices.
